Douglas Phillipson wrote:

> The PVR-350 has a "Composite out" jack where the 250 appears not to. 
> Can you get the Video out of this jack, by default,  when you play a 
> video with MythTV or is there some extra config/magic you have to go 
> through to get it?

There is a non-trivial amount of "magic" required to get teh 350's TV 
Out working, but it's not terribly difficult if you follow instructions. 
There's an excellent set on this very forum; just do a search for the 
partial subject "very long" and you'll find it. The 250, BTW not only 
does not have the output, it also does not have the onboard decoder that 
drives the output. OTOH, the 250 Freestyle cards you find on eBay 
(Gateway pulls) are actually closer to the 350, in that they actually 
have the decoder on the board, but have no TV Out port or IR remote 
plug. I seem to remember seeing someone posting about trying to use the 
Freestyle's decoder much like a DVD decoder board, as a branch of IVTV 
driver development IIRC, but that's a while down the road for sure.
